Shimoda Onsen, set on the western shore of the remote Amakusa island chain (part of Kumamoto Prefecture), seems as peaceful and idyllic as a simple town can be.  There are foot baths, hot, iron rich waters, and a host of pretty sight-seeing in the nearby coastline and mountains.  If you just want a quiet spot to escape from it all, look no further.  If you need nightlife, glitz, or glamour, you're in about the wrongest spot you can possibly be.

Getting here can be done by bus, but really requires a car for any decent sightseeing and daily activities.  You can arrive on Amakusa either by the bridge or by ferry, but once here, plan on lengthy waits for the public transport.
